A full term delivery is approximately nine months, about 38 weeks. Any pregnancy where the child is delivered before 36 weeks is considered a premature deliver. However, any deliver before 26 weeks gestation is likely nonviable, and the baby is normally not delivered alive. Babies born between 26 weeks and 36 weeks that are premature can be subject to many health risks that include lung problems, which can affect the brain due to lack of oxygen, as well as cause neurological injury. The longer a baby is able to be kept in the womb by delaying the delivery, the better chance of survival and avoidance of birth defects. Premature delivery is the single largest cause of newborn death.
There are certain set procedures that your doctor should do to attempt to lengthen the gestation period as long as possible to avoid this problem. One is injection of steroids to decrease the problem of lung development and brain injury, as it works to speed up the development of both lungs and brain. Once a premature baby is delivered, it requires special care in a neonatal intensive care unit, where there are very specific treatments to ensure the baby's survival. If these procedures are not correctly done, you may lose your child, or have an infant born with brain or lung injuries.
